I have several boards each with several child boards, and a couple with grand-child boards. They all have the option "Collapsible: Allow users to collapse this category" selected. Yet I can not find out how to collapse any of the boards.

Thanks in advance for any assistance!

Sorck

If you go to your index page, look for a little [-] which is in a box just to th left of a category name, look at the image I've atatched and the arrow points to what you should be looking for ;)
